§ 39-1-9. Clerk — Oath of office.

The commission shall appoint an employee of the division as its clerk, who shall serve during its pleasure. The commissioners and clerk shall be sworn to the faithful discharge of the duties of their offices and, before entering upon their offices, shall file a certificate of their oaths for record in the office of the secretary of state.
